Maintaining Integrity in Online Gambling: The Critical Role of Content Regulation and Compliance

Online gambling has emerged as a dominant force within the global gaming landscape, driven by technological innovations, expanding digital access, and evolving consumer preferences. According to recent industry reports, the UK’s digital gambling sector is projected to generate over £5 billion annually, underscoring its economic significance (Statista, 2023). Yet, this growth brings increased responsibility—particularly for regulatory bodies and platform administrators—to ensure that gambling content remains fair, transparent, and within legal bounds.

The Essence of Regulatory Oversight in Online Gambling

At the heart of maintaining public confidence and protecting consumers is the rigorous oversight instituted by authorities like the UK Gambling Commission (UKGC). Their mandate extends beyond licensing to encompass the ongoing monitoring of gambling platforms for compliance with legal standards. This includes scrutinizing marketing practices, verifying the integrity of games, and curbing illicit activities that could undermine the industry’s credibility.

One of the key areas where this oversight manifests is in the identification and investigation of violations related to gambling content. Misleading advertising, unlicensed promotion, and the dissemination of unauthorized gambling material pose significant risks not only to consumers but also to the reputation of the entire sector.

Understanding Gambling Content Violations and Their Impact

Gambling content violations encompass a broad spectrum of infractions, including:

  • Promotion of unlicensed or black-market gambling platforms
  • Misleading advertising that exaggerates odds or wins
  • Sharing of unethical or inappropriate gambling narratives
  • Failure to adhere to age restrictions and responsible gambling messages

Such violations can have grave consequences. They can mislead consumers into risky gambling behaviors, facilitate underage access, and erode trust in licensed operators. Recognizing these risks, regulators have increasingly prioritized the detection and sanctioning of non-compliant content.

The Role of Digital Platforms and Industry Self-Regulation

While government regulators enforce laws, industry entities must also uphold high standards through self-regulatory measures. Platforms hosting gambling advertising or content are advised to employ advanced moderation tools and screening protocols. Notably, legal frameworks now emphasize the importance of transparency and accountability, necessitating transparent reporting mechanisms.
